My co-worker, Anne Keisman, recently came to me for advice on how she could get started using social media to promote web content. Anne is the online media coordinator for Green Hour® , an NWF program geared toward getting children outside in nature. Anne is having a lot of success at doing this on Green Hour's Twitter page.
